Branches: Newsletter of the Volunteers of The Morton Arboretum, Autumn 1986 (3.107026)
Date: 1986Type: Serial
Description:This digitized issue of the Autumn 1986 Branches Newsletter features: an article on the selection and creation of the computer system for the files of the live and dead plants at the Arboretum, including volunteers Jack Pfister and Randy Herber who mentored and guided the process; the volunteer recognition for that year; and an article on the Visitors Center dedicated in 1973 in honor of Sophia Preston Owsky Morton, designed by architect Arthur Myhrum and commissioned by Suzette Morton Zurcher (later Davidson); the staff at the Visitors Center are also featured in some detail. Educational opportunities, volunteer opportunities and new volunteers are also featured.

Branches: Newsletter of the Volunteers of The Morton Arboretum, Spring 1986 (3.107027)
Date: 1986Creator: Kaskey, Marjorie
Type: Serial
Description:This digitized issue of the Spring 1986 Branches Newsletter features the following articles: the battle against the Eastern Tent Caterpillars using a team of volunteers to avoid spraying; wildflowers at the Arboretum including the Wild Garden at the Outpost; Ray Schulenberg's, Curator of Collections, process of adding and locating plants in the Arboretum in tandem with Tony Tyznik. Upcoming educational and volunteer opportunities are included as well as new and featured volunteers.

Branches: Newsletter of the Volunteers of The Morton Arboretum, Summer 1986 (3.107028)
Date: 1986Creator: Stowell, Gladys
Type: Serial
Description:This digitized issue of the Summer 1986 Branches Newsletter features articles on; the establishment of the Woody Herb Garden with the help of volunteer Bonnie Paulson, waste water treatment at the Arboretum, the monitoring of the lakes and ponds at the Arboretum in conjunction wit the Illinois EPA and the establishment of new geographic collections in Sargent's Glade consisting of plants of the Pacific Northwest, the Rockies and the Southwest. Upcoming events and activities at the Arboretum are featured along with volunteer opportunities and a feature on new volunteers.

Events, News, & Classes: Winter 1986 (3.113786)
Date: 1986Type: Serial
Description:A digitized version of the Winter 1986 Events, News, & Classes Newsletter. This issue features events such as a discussion on the "The Romance of Botanical Names" and "Resource Conservation in an Urban Environment". There was a field trip to watch bald eagles in Savanna, IL. Charles A. Lewis, the Arboretum's Collections Group Administrator, was honored with the G.B. Gunslogson Medal for "the creative use of home gardening in benefiting people-plant relationships and the future of American life" from the American Horticultural Society. The woody plant collections were to be computerized. A new maple, 'Marmo', was introduced. Members were also encourage to write Lt. Governor George Ryan to advocate for the development of a lake on the Danada Forrest Preserve as part of the Briarcliff Flood Control Program.
